SUMMARY OF EXPERIENCE
Imtiaj Rasul is a participatory development specialist. Since 1996, he is actively involved in research, advocacy, and intervention programs related to public health, poverty, human development, water & sanitation, environment, migration, rural & urban housing, education, marginalized community, social policy and development strategy. During his career he worked with Grameen Trust (sister concern of Grameen Bank), Winona State University (USA), Whitman College (USA), The University of Exeter, Exeter (UK),Research Initiatives, Bangladesh (RIB), MRC Mode Ltd., BRAC Development Institute (BDI), BRAC University, American Alumni Association (AAA) and PROGGA. Mr. Imtiaj has extensive experience in designing training programs for advocacy and campaign for specific professionals ie journalists, public health experts then continuously follow up with them to ensure their dissemination to various stakeholders. He also enjoys networking with knowledge institutions in South Asia and delivering lectures at reputed universities in USA, UK, India and Bangladesh.
